What is Organic Farming? 🤔

Organic farming means growing plants and animals in a natural way. Farmers do not use synthetic fertilizers or pesticides. They use natural methods to help their crops grow. This helps to keep the soil and water clean.

Techniques of Organic Farming 🌾

1. Crop Rotation 🔄

Crop rotation means changing what you plant in a field every year. This helps the soil stay healthy. For example, if a farmer grows corn one year, they can grow beans the next year. Different plants use different nutrients from the soil.

2. Composting ♻️

Composting is like making food for plants! When we put kitchen scraps, like fruit peels and vegetable ends, together with leaves and grass, it turns into rich soil. This helps plants grow strong and healthy.

3. Natural Pest Control 🐛

Instead of using chemicals to kill bugs, organic farmers use natural ways to control pests. They can plant flowers that attract good bugs. These good bugs eat the bad bugs. Farmers can also use safe sprays made from plants.

4. Cover Cropping 🌿

Cover cropping means planting special plants in a field after the main crop is harvested. These plants protect the soil from erosion, which happens when wind and rain wash away soil. They also put nutrients back into the ground!

What Are Some Cover Crops? 🌼

  • Clovers
  • Rye
  • Vetch
  • Mustard

5. Mulching 🍂

Mulching is putting a layer of material on top of the soil. This can be grass, straw, or wood chips. Mulch helps keep the soil moist and stops weeds from growing. It’s like giving the soil a cozy blanket!

6. Permaculture 🌳

Permaculture is a way of farming that works with nature. It means creating a garden that looks like a forest. This garden has many plants and animals living together. They help each other grow!
